Rekursiver Vergleich von Dateiidentitäten in Windows-Umgebungen nur mit Standard-Windows-Befehlszeilentools

439
Samuel Russell

Ich möchte sicherstellen, dass tiefe Verzeichnisse nach dem Kopieren identisch sind.

Ich habe diese Antwort gelesen: https://superuser.com/a/414216/214579

Jedoch bieten weder fc noch comp eine Rekursion. Wie würde man rekursives Testen in einer reinen Windows-Umgebung implementieren?

Diese Antwort zeigt deutlich, dass Robocopy wahrscheinlich sehr nützlich ist: https://superuser.com/a/748518/214579

0
Ich stimme der Vorstellung von Robocopy zu. Schau es dir genauer an, es kann den Trick tun. ;-) TheUser1024 vor 10 Jahren 1

1 Antwort auf die Frage

1
Julian Knight

Ja, Sie können und sollten Robocopy dafür verwenden.

robocopy c:\folder1 c:\folder2 \mir 

Vergewissert sich, dass beide Ordner einschließlich Unterordner identisch sind. Es werden auch Dateien gelöscht, die gelöscht wurden.

Es gibt auch viele andere Optionen, einschließlich der Möglichkeit, Ordner auf Änderungen zu überprüfen, erneut zu versuchen, ob Dateien gesperrt sind usw.